If I take a course for let's say a bcs in Pharmaceutical science in Kingston would I be able to apply for a MPham in Medway or another uni after? I'm really confused on what I can and can't do. And the new ucas tariff isn't helping either ...

Do you mean study a 3 year BSc Pharmaceutical Science at Kingston and when you've finished apply to start again on (or somehow "top up" to) an MPharm elsewhere?

That isn't a usual route. Kingston offer transfers onto their MPharm course - in theory you might be able to get onto the MPharm and then switch to an MPharm elsewhere part way through the course but that's a risky route - the changes to tariff aren't likely to affect entry requirements in any way (just the way they're expressed). Transferring courses or universities isn't a back door route onto competitive courses if you don't have the standard entry requirements.
